At a glance

Diamond Muay Thai has been running on Koh Phangan since 2011, making it one of the island's most established camps. Training runs twice daily Monday to Saturday with two-hour sessions. The trainer roster includes veterans with 200 to 400 professional fights. All equipment is provided on arrival. Students who want to compete can fight representing the gym at monthly island fight nights or at larger stadiums in South Thailand. Accommodation ranges from fan bungalows to air-conditioned deluxe suites within walking distance of Nai Wok beach.

Trainers

Kru Chok Rittisak
Head trainer
200+ fights, 30 years, former Rajadamnern champion, Yellow Jacket for 10+ consecutive title defences
One of the most decorated trainers on the island. Kru Chok defended his Rajadamnern title more than ten times and has spent 30 years in the sport, overseeing all training at Diamond.
Kru Santos
Trainer
400+ fights, 30+ years, multiple South Thailand titles, Lumpinee and Rajadamnern veteran, brother of the late Nokweed Davy
With over 400 fights across South Thailand and both Bangkok stadiums, Kru Santos brings exceptional depth to his teaching. Private sessions with him are available at a premium rate.
Kru Pok
Co-founder and trainer
200+ fights, 30 years, multiple Rajadamnern and Lumpini champion, international bouts in Australia, Oman, Singapore, and Korea
One of the two founding trainers at Diamond. Kru Pok has competed internationally across four countries and holds multiple stadium championships.
Kru Nop
Trainer
150+ fights, 30 years, clinch specialist
A clinch specialist with three decades in the sport. Known for strong English and patient technique correction.
Kru Baow
Trainer and active fighter
200+ fights, 20+ years, active on MX Muay Xtreme, Thai Fight, and Max Muay Thai
Still competing at top domestic promotions while teaching at Diamond, bringing current competitive insight to his sessions.

Training and schedule

Monday to Saturday. Morning class 08:00 to 10:00, afternoon class 16:00 to 18:00. Muay Thai Fitness on Tuesday, Thursday, and Saturday 12:00 to 13:00. Yoga Monday, Wednesday, and Friday 13:00 to 14:30. Closed Sunday.

Who it suits

A strong choice for beginners who want real technique with genuine Thai trainers and for experienced students or fighters who want to compete during their stay. The bungalow-to-suite accommodation range suits longer stays. Not ideal for those who need MMA or BJJ alongside Muay Thai.

Common questions

How far is Diamond from the ferry port?
About five minutes by taxi from the ThongSala ferry pier.
Do I need to bring my own gloves?
No. All equipment including gloves and hand wraps is provided on site.
Can I compete while training here?
Yes. The gym places students in monthly fight nights on the island and in larger stadiums around South Thailand when both trainer and student agree readiness.
